fix definition
check code / check-code (push) Successful in 32s Details

This commit is contained in:
Ivan Schaller 2024-02-28 14:38:08 +01:00
parent 59a9b01fef
commit 29cf05c888
1 changed files with 11 additions and 15 deletions

View File

@ -377,13 +377,11 @@ class NetBoxDNSSource(octodns.provider.base.BaseProvider):
case octodns.record.Update(): case octodns.record.Update():
rcd_name = "@" if change.existing.name == "" else change.existing.name rcd_name = "@" if change.existing.name == "" else change.existing.name
nb_records: pynetbox.core.response.RecordSet = ( nb_records = self.api.plugins.netbox_dns.records.filter(
self.api.plugins.netbox_dns.records.filter(
zone_id=nb_zone.id, zone_id=nb_zone.id,
name=rcd_name, name=rcd_name,
type=change.existing._type, type=change.existing._type,
) )
)
existing_changeset = self._format_changeset(change.existing) existing_changeset = self._format_changeset(change.existing)
new_changeset = self._format_changeset(change.new) new_changeset = self._format_changeset(change.new)
@ -400,8 +398,7 @@ class NetBoxDNSSource(octodns.provider.base.BaseProvider):
nb_record.save() nb_record.save()
for record in to_create: for record in to_create:
nb_record: pynetbox.core.response.Record = ( nb_record = self.api.plugins.netbox_dns.records.create(
self.api.plugins.netbox_dns.records.create(
zone=nb_zone.id, zone=nb_zone.id,
name=rcd_name, name=rcd_name,
type=change.new._type, type=change.new._type,
@ -409,5 +406,4 @@ class NetBoxDNSSource(octodns.provider.base.BaseProvider):
value=record.replace("\\\\", "\\").replace("\\;", ";"), value=record.replace("\\\\", "\\").replace("\\;", ";"),
disable_ptr=True, disable_ptr=True,
) )
)
self.log.debug(f"{nb_record!r}") self.log.debug(f"{nb_record!r}")